Slum2school Africa is a volunteer-driven developmental organization with a vision to transform the society by empowering disadvantaged children to realize their full potential. Founded in 2012, we recognize that there are severe shortcomings in the educational sector in Africa and in this area, seek to improve the lives of Africa's most precious resource - her children. We provide educational scholarships, create learning spaces and provide other psychosocial support for disadvantaged and vulnerable children in slums and indigent communities.

Job Summary

  • As the Corporate Communications Manager, you will strengthen Slum2School’s corporate identity, manage media relations, and develop external communications strategies that reinforce donor confidence, brand integrity, and narrative impact.
  • You will articulate our mission to diverse stakeholders, including donors, partners, beneficiaries, and the media.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ain a cohesive corporate communications strategy aligned with organizational goals.
  • Craft external messaging—brochures, newsletters, press releases, donor reports, impact summaries.
  • Ensure consistent brand tone and positioning across all corporate touchpoints.
  • Serve as the primary press/media liaison—drafting press releases, coordinating media interviews, and managing inquiries.
  • Build and maintain relationships with journalists, media outlets, and CSR partners.
  • Track media coverage and generate monthly media visibility reports.
  • Contribute to corporate fundraising materials, sponsorship proposals, and donor reports.
  • Prepare talking points and briefing documents for leadership and board members.
  • Support corporate events and corporate stakeholder engagement activities.
  • Act as a communications advisor during issues or crises, ensuring timely and professional external responses.
  • Monitor sentiment across press, social media, and other industry platforms.
  • Coordinate closely with the Marketing/Volunteer and Program teams to maintain integrated messaging and storytelling.
  • Ensure operational support for broader communications campaigns and events.

Required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in Communications, Public Relations, Journalism, Business, Development Studies, or related field.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in corporate communications, PR, or external affairs, preferably in non-profit environment.
  • Ability to write compelling content in a narrative style tailored to audiences; strong storytelling instincts.
  • Media relations experience and familiarity with Nigerian/international press landscapes.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ills.
